This research is to determine the influence of organizational climate, authentic leadership and knowledge sharing on innovative work behavior of employees at the Human Resources Bureau of the Ministry of Finance. The research method used is a quantitative method, with a sample size of 170 respondents from a population of 297 employees. The data collection technique used in this research is distributing questionnaires, while data processing uses the SPSS 23 program. The analytical methods used include instrument testing, classical assumption testing, hypothesis testing and multiple linear regression testing. This research shows that organizational climate has a positive influence on innovative work behavior, authentic leadership has a positive influence on innovative work behavior and knowledge sharing has a positive influence on innovative work behavior. This research can pave the way for increasing employee readiness in facing global technological developments.
